Issued in 1990, this 6.50 dinar Yugoslavian stamp commemorates the 125th anniversary of the International Telecommunication Union (UIT). The design by M. Kalezić-Krajinović juxtaposes past and present forms of communication—a telegraph operator from the early days of telecommunications and a modern computer screen displaying “125.” The UIT emblem symbolizes global connectivity, while the artwork celebrates technological evolution and international cooperation in communication.
